Legg-Calvé-Perthes Disease
A childhood condition that occurs when blood supply to the femoral head is temporarily interrupted, leading to bone death, and potentially causing hip joint problems.
Corrective Appliance
A device used to modify the structural arrangement of dental or skeletal parts, such as braces for teeth.
Desquamated Skin
Skin that is peeling or shedding off, often as a part of the natural regeneration process or due to certain skin conditions.
Sebaceous Secretions
Oily substances produced by sebaceous glands in the skin, helping to lubricate and protect the skin and hair.
